i got a question.. I got a 400ex.. which motor would be better to put in and why.. the CRF or TRX...

44oEX
11-09-2006, 05:29 PM
well the carb on the CRF comes out the back of the motor on a angle, that will cause problems in the ex frame, but the kickstarter housing on the trx is higher up, and will hit on the rear shock rezzie, if you have a stock rear shock, with the crf you would probably have to cut your rear fenders to make you kickstart clear since it's reverse kick, the trx would be easyer since it's forward.

they both have there good and bad point, but if your good at fabritating stuff, go for the CRF, more power.

Ignition is totally different, Tranny is totally different, Porting and headwork have difference, Clutch is different, Cam is totally different. The CRF motor is lighter isn't it? Exhaust is different. Honda says the TRX motor is CRF like now..... It's more like a CRF than it was, but still way different. It really depends on which year model CRF your talking about. The TRX's are close to the 2003 I believe, but the 2007's are WAY ahead.

I'm waiting to tear down my CRF to see how different they really are internally.

Some say the TRX has more potential, some say the CRF does...
Each can get into the 60hp range with a stock bore, with massive torque.
